Boxdy also known as Boxty refers to an Irish simple potato pancakes. Traditionally, boxdy is a mixture of grated raw potatoes, leftover mashed potatoes, baking powder, and sweet milk. Nowadays, boxdy is cooked with added flavors, like onions and/or garlic.
